by Armand Silvestre (1837 - 1901)

Suivons le vol des papillons
Language: French (Français) 
La Première
Suivons le vol des papillons
Qui voltigent sur les abîmes.

La Seconde
— Sur l’aile des aigles fuyons
Jusque vers la neige des cimes.

La Première
— Abeilles, sur votre chemin,
Croissent le lis et le jasmin.

La Seconde
— O mouettes, votre aile blanche
Sur le gouffre des mers se penche.

Ensemble
Plutôt, ma sœur, par les détours
Du grand bois où dorment les tombes,
Trouvons le chemin des colombes !
C’est là qu’on peut aimer toujours !

Confirmed with Poésies de Armand Silvestre, 1872-1878: La chanson des Heures, Volume 2, Paris, Alphonse Lemerre, 1887, pages 183-184.


Text Authorship:

  • by Armand Silvestre (1837 - 1901), "Pour deux voix de femmes", written 1878?, appears in La chanson des heures, poésies nouvelles 1874-1878, in 6. Vers pour être chantés, in 12. Madrigaux dans le goût ancien, no. 7, Paris, Éd. G. Charpentier, first published 1878 [author's text checked 1 time against a primary source]

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):

  • by Charlotte Devéria, née Thomas (1856 - 1885), "Les papillons" [ vocal duet for soprano and mezzo-soprano with piano ], from Vingt mélodies, 3ème recueil, no. 20, Éd. "Au Ménestrel", Heugel [sung text not yet checked]
